Alsaceteam : economic operator of the new governance of the Ports of Mulhouse-Rhine
Within Alsaceteam, Swissterminal AG, the Grand Port Maritime de Marseille and the Grand Port Fluvio-Maritime de l'axe Seine will develop multimodal connections, including rail services, between the French seaports and the hinterland of the Swiss-France-German tri-border region. This partnership offers the opportunity to link three-borders region to the Mediterranean in addition to its opening to the English Channel and the North Sea.

Gender equality at the port of Marseille Fos
Over the period from 1 January to 31 December 2020, the port of Marseille Fos achieved a total of 97 out of 100. That’s a good score!
Professional equality between women and men
This index must be calculated based on 5 indicators: pay gaps, individual increases, promotions, the percentage of employees receiving an increase upon return from maternity and the number of employees of the under-represented gender among the 10 highest paid in the company.
